Easy Hot Dog Chili Mac Casserole
Looking for a quick and delicious weeknight dinner idea? This Easy Hot Dog Chili Mac Casserole is the perfect solution! Packed with flavor and easy to make, this comforting casserole will become a family favorite in no time.
Ingredients:
- 1 pound hot dogs, sliced
- 1 onion, diced
- 1 can chili
- 1 box elbow macaroni
- 1 cup shredded cheddar cheese
- Salt and pepper to taste
Instructions:
- Preheat oven to 350°F.
- Cook macaroni according to package instructions, then drain and set aside.
- In a skillet, sauté hot dog slices and onions until hot dogs are browned.
- Add chili to the skillet and stir to combine.
- In a large mixing bowl, combine cooked macaroni and chili mixture. Mix well.
- Transfer to a baking dish and top with shredded cheddar cheese.
- Bake for 20 minutes, or until cheese is melted and bubbly.
- Serve hot and enjoy!

Helpful Tips:
- Top with crushed tortilla chips for added crunch.
- Sprinkle with chopped green onions for a pop of color.
- Try adding a dollop of sour cream before serving.
- Experiment with different types of chili for unique flavor profiles.
- For a spicier kick, add some cayenne pepper or chili flakes to the chili mixture.
- Drizzle with BBQ sauce for a smoky flavor twist.
- Substitute ground beef or turkey for the hot dogs for a different protein option.
- Mix in some cooked bacon pieces for an extra savory touch.
- Use a blend of cheeses like Monterey Jack and Colby for a cheesy twist.
- For a tex-mex flair, add some black beans and diced jalapeños to the chili mixture.
Expert Secrets:
- Cook the macaroni al dente to prevent it from becoming mushy in the casserole.
- Let the casserole rest for a few minutes before serving to allow the flavors to meld together.
- Adjust the seasoning of the chili mixture to suit your taste preferences.
- For a creamier texture, mix in a can of creamy soup like cheddar cheese or mushroom soup.
- Freshly grated cheese melts better than pre-shredded cheese for a gooey topping.
- Cover the casserole with foil while baking to prevent the cheese from burning.
- Try adding a splash of Worcestershire sauce or soy sauce to the chili mixture for added umami flavor.
- For a zesty twist, mix in some salsa or taco seasoning into the chili mixture.
- Garnish with fresh cilantro or parsley before serving for a burst of freshness.
- Leftover casserole can be reheated in the oven or microwave for a quick meal later on.
